Production of antibodies specific to human chorionic gonadotropin in mice immunized against its chemical analogs
Authors:Kambadur Muralidhar  Om P Bhal
Institution:(1) School of Life Sciences, University of Hyderabad, 500 134 Hyderabad;(2) Department of Biological Sciences, Division of Cell and Molecular Biology, S.U.N.Y. at Buffalo, 14260 Buffalo, N.Y., USA
Abstract:Mice immunized against DS5-hCG-Β and DS6-hCG-Β, chemical analogs of Β-subunit of human choriogonadotropin (hCG-Β) in which 5 and 6 disulphide bonds respectively were reduced and alkylated, were found to produce antibodies specific to hCG without significant crossreactivity with human lutropin (hLH) as tested in a radioimmunoassay. In contrast, mice immunized against the native hCG-Β subunit produced hLH crossreacting antibodies. While the anti-DS5, DS6-hCG-Β serum was capable of selectively blocking the binding of 125I]-hCG to rat testicular LH/hCG receptors, it failed to inhibit the binding of 125I]-hLH to the same receptors. The radioimmunoassay for hCG using the mouse anti-DS5, DS6-hCG-Β serum was not as sensitive as that employing rabbit anti-DS5, DS6-hCG-Β serum. The minimal detection limit was 5 ng/ml for the mouse antibody as compared to 1 ng/ml for the rabbit antibody. Supported by U.S. Public Health Service Grant HD 08766 to OPB.
